Output 173b234d74a615731f1ccf2b89edc04809a04e3706c776770c215baf6ec24a53:0

value
1139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 745ffb963d38b902f106afb1e3d63421f9a480b0 OP_EQUAL
address
3CJMHo5TwoqiFLhWSTLDhzsqDL9dD5URfz
transaction
173b234d74a615731f1ccf2b89edc04809a04e3706c776770c215baf6ec24a53
spent
true